Dufferin statue, Belfast (1)
This statue, in an ornate “temple”, is of the first Marquis of Dufferin. He was Governor-General of Canada, ambassador to Russia and Viceroy of India (although not all at the same time). It stands in the grounds of the City Hall overlooking Donegall Square West. It was jointly composed by Brumwell Thomas and Frederick Pomeroy.
